How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Austell?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Austell Studio Apartments | $1,524 | $1,399 | $1,624 |
Austell 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,620 | $732 | $2,881 |
Austell 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,849 | $984 | $3,368 |
Austell 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,986 | $1,361 | $4,332 |
Austell 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,378 | $1,860 | $2,705 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
